Heim > Backend-Entwicklung > PHP-Problem > So testen Sie, ob die Schnittstelle in PHP langsam läuft

So testen Sie, ob die Schnittstelle in PHP langsam läuft

angryTom
Freigeben: 2023-02-28 09:32:01
Original
3506 Leute haben es durchsucht

So testen Sie, ob die Schnittstelle in PHP langsam läuft

So testen Sie, ob die Schnittstelle in PHP langsam läuft

Um zu sehen, ob unser Programm langsam läuft, Wir müssen die Laufzeit testen. Die Mikrozeitfunktion kann jedoch die Programmausführungszeit analysieren. Hier erfahren Sie, wie Sie es verwenden.

1. Verwenden Sie die Variable $time_start am Anfang des Programms, um die Zeit zu erfassen, zu der das Programm startet.

<?php
//开始时间
$time_start = microtime(true);

//程序部分
Nach dem Login kopieren

2. Verwenden Sie die Variable $time_end am Ende des Programms, um die Laufzeit des Programmendes aufzuzeichnen.

//结束时间
$time_end = microtime(true);
Nach dem Login kopieren

3. Verwenden Sie abschließend die Endzeit minus der Startzeit, um die Programmlaufzeit zu erhalten. Ist die Zeit zu lang, läuft die Schnittstelle etwas langsam und das Programm muss optimiert werden.

Hinweis: Die Einheit ist Sekunden

//相减得到运行时间
$time = $time_end - $time_start;
echo $time;
Nach dem Login kopieren

4. Test

<?php
$time_start = microtime(true);
// 模拟处理
sleep(3);
$time_end = microtime(true);
$time = $time_end - $time_start;
echo &#39;<br>&#39;, $time, &#39;<br>&#39;;
Nach dem Login kopieren

Ergebnis:

3
Nach dem Login kopieren

Weitere PHP-bezogene Kenntnisse finden Sie auf der PHP-Chinese-Website!

Das obige ist der detaillierte Inhalt vonSo testen Sie, ob die Schnittstelle in PHP langsam läuft.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age